Author: Michael

Free at Last

June 10, 2020 The Lockdown at Neema Village is over and the President says Tanzania is free at last from Corona! ¬†That is such a relief to know!¬†With 60 babies on campus and a large staff caring for them it was a rough time with almost a hundred people including the babies, volunteer directors, five … Continued

When you leave this earth you can take nothing you have received, only what you have given.
St. Francis of Assisi